Answer:
Total cost for tiles and paints is $924.
Step-by-step explanation:
We have been given that a community hall is in the shape of a cuboid. The hall is 40m long 15m high and 3m wide.
The paint will be required for 4 walls and ceiling.
Let us find area of walls and ceiling.
[tex]\text{Area of walls and ceiling}=(2*40*15)+(2*3*15)+(40*3)[/tex]
[tex]\text{Area of walls and ceiling}=1200+90+120[/tex]
[tex]\text{Area of walls and ceiling}=1410[/tex]
Therefore, the area of walls and ceiling is 1410 square meters.
Given: Cost for 10 litre of paint is $10 and 10 litre paint covers 25 square meter. Therefore,
[tex]\text{ The total painting cost}=10*(\frac{1410}{25})[/tex]
[tex]\text{ The total painting cost}=10*56.4=564[/tex]
Therefore, the total painting cost is $564.
Tiles will be required for floor. Let us find the area of floor.
[tex]\text{Area of floor} = 40*3\text{ square meters}[/tex]
[tex]\text{Area of floor} =120\text{ square meters}[/tex]
Given: 1m squared floor tiles costs $3. So,
[tex]\text{Total cost for tiles} = 3*120 = 360[/tex]
Therefore, the total cost for tiles is $360.
Now let us find combined total cost of tiles and paint.
[tex]\text{Combined total cost}= 564+360 = 924[/tex]
Therefore, the combined total cost of tiles and paint is $924.
